Clientage
see synonyms of clientageNoun
1. clientage
relation of a client to a patron

Clientage
see synonyms of clientagenoun
customers or clients collectively

Clientage
see synonyms of clientage noun
all one's clients or customers, collectively
: also ˈclientage (ˈklaɪəntɪdʒ
